HT's second grade classes recently went on a field trip to the Wakefield Wildlife Sanctuary, a Kennebec Land Trust (KLT) property located in West Gardiner. Students learned about Earth's water cycle and how water can cause fast and slow changes to landforms. They also learned about soil erosion and how human and animal activity can alter the flow of water in ways that change landforms. Students learned that beavers can do this very effectively by building dams and then used their scientist skills to construct their own dams using clay (to serve as mud) and items found on the forest floor (sticks, pinecones, pine needles, and dirt) to build and test two models of a beaver dam. After observing how water flowed through or around their first dam, students worked in teams to modify their designs. Students then conducted a second test to observe how the water flow changed. In spite of the wet and cold, students had a great time and learned a lot of information. Many thanks to the Kennebec Land Trust, who provided this program at no cost, to our parent volunteers, and to HT's PTG, who covered transportation costs.
